Reporting To: General CounselRole Summary:The Assistant Manager - Legal will play a pivotal role in our client's legal operations. This position involves drafting and negotiating commercial contracts, conducting land due diligence, supporting M&A transactions, performing regulatory research, and collaborating with internal and global stakeholders. The ideal candidate will bring strong legal acumen, industry-specific knowledge, and the ability to manage complex legal matters in the renewable energy sector.Key Responsibilities:Contract Management
  • Draft, review, and negotiate a wide range of commercial agreements including:
  • NDAs, Purchase Orders, Work Orders, and Service Agreements
  • EPC Contracts and O&M Agreements
  • Lease Deeds, Sale Deeds, Easement Agreements
  • Procurement and other project-related contracts
Land Due Diligence
  • Support land acquisition processes through title verification and legal clearances.
  • Prepare and finalize land-related documentation such as lease deeds, sale deeds, and conveyance deeds.
  • Coordinate with internal land teams and external legal advisors to ensure statutory compliance.
M&A Transaction Support
  • Assist in legal due diligence, transaction structuring, and documentation for mergers and acquisitions.
  • Review and analyze key agreements including SPAs, SHAs, and JV contracts.
Regulatory Compliance & Research
  • Conduct legal research on applicable laws and regulations affecting renewable energy projects (e.g., electricity, land, environmental).
  • Track policy updates and advise on compliance requirements.
Stakeholder Engagement
  • Collaborate with internal departments such as Projects, Finance, and Procurement.
  • Liaise with external stakeholders including law firms, government bodies, and counterparties.
  • Coordinate with global legal teams on cross-border transactions and compliance matters.
Qualifications & Skills:
  • Education: LL.B. / BA LL.B. from a recognized institution
  • Bar Enrollment: Must be enrolled with the Bar Council
  • Experience: 3-5 years in contract law, infrastructure/renewable energy, or corporate transactions (in-house or law firm)
  • Core Competencies:
  • Strong grasp of contract law, electricity regulations, and land laws
  • Excellent drafting, negotiation, and analytical skills
  • Ability to work independently and manage diverse stakeholders
  • Prior experience in the renewable energy sector is preferred
